What is a diesel mechanics major?
Studies in diesel mechanics teaches individuals to use what they learn to repair, service, and maintain diesel engines in vehicles such as automobiles, buses, ships, trucks, railroad locomotives, and construction equipment; as well as stationary diesel engines in electrical generators and related equipment.

How popular is diesel mechanics as a major?
Each year, around 30 students obtain a bachelor’s degree and around 2,560 students obtain an associate degree in diesel mechanics. In 2021, 26 students received a bachelor's degree and 2,349 students received an associate degree. This is relatively the same number of diesel mechanics majors as there were in 2020. Diesel mechanics is one of the most popular majors within mechanics.
